.t2-featured-query-post .t2-post-link,.t2-featured-single-post .t2-post-link,.t2-featured-template-post .t2-post-link{height:auto;transition:color .2s}.t2-featured-query-post .wp-block-group>*,.t2-featured-single-post .wp-block-group>*,.t2-featured-template-post .wp-block-group>*{margin-block-start:0}.t2-featured-query-post .post-content,.t2-featured-single-post .post-content,.t2-featured-template-post .post-content{padding:var(--wp--preset--spacing--40) 0}.t2-featured-query-post .t2-post-featured-image,.t2-featured-single-post .t2-post-featured-image,.t2-featured-template-post .t2-post-featured-image{border-radius:8px;overflow:hidden}.t2-featured-query-post .t2-post-featured-image img,.t2-featured-single-post .t2-post-featured-image img,.t2-featured-template-post .t2-post-featured-image img{transition:transform .8s ease}.t2-featured-query-post:not(.t2-featured-content-layout-col-12) .t2-post-featured-image,.t2-featured-single-post:not(.t2-featured-content-layout-col-12) .t2-post-featured-image,.t2-featured-template-post:not(.t2-featured-content-layout-col-12) .t2-post-featured-image{aspect-ratio:9/6}.t2-featured-query-post .featured-image,.t2-featured-single-post .featured-image,.t2-featured-template-post .featured-image{padding:0}.t2-featured-query-post .featured-image figure,.t2-featured-single-post .featured-image figure,.t2-featured-template-post .featured-image figure{aspect-ratio:auto;margin:0}.t2-featured-query-post .post-details,.t2-featured-single-post .post-details,.t2-featured-template-post .post-details{align-items:center;display:flex;font-size:var(--wp--preset--font-size--text-xxs);gap:var(--wp--preset--spacing--20);margin-bottom:var(--wp--preset--spacing--30)}.t2-featured-query-post .t2-post-dynamic-part.term-category,.t2-featured-single-post .t2-post-dynamic-part.term-category,.t2-featured-template-post .t2-post-dynamic-part.term-category{background:var(--wp--preset--color--background-100);border-radius:50px;color:var(--wp--preset--color--neutral-black);padding:var(--wp--preset--spacing--10) var(--wp--preset--spacing--30)}.t2-featured-query-post .wp-block-post-date,.t2-featured-single-post .wp-block-post-date,.t2-featured-template-post .wp-block-post-date{color:var(--wp--preset--color--neutral-grey)}.t2-featured-query-post .t2-post-title,.t2-featured-single-post .t2-post-title,.t2-featured-template-post .t2-post-title{font-size:clamp(1.4rem,1.5rem,1.7rem);margin-bottom:var(--wp--preset--spacing--20);padding:0;transition:color .2s}.t2-featured-query-post .t2-post-dynamic-part.meta-abstract,.t2-featured-query-post .wp-block-dekode-story-abstract,.t2-featured-single-post .t2-post-dynamic-part.meta-abstract,.t2-featured-single-post .wp-block-dekode-story-abstract,.t2-featured-template-post .t2-post-dynamic-part.meta-abstract,.t2-featured-template-post .wp-block-dekode-story-abstract{font-size:var(--wp--preset--font-size--text-small);transition:color .2s}.t2-featured-query-post .t2-post-dynamic-part .wp-block-buttons,.t2-featured-single-post .t2-post-dynamic-part .wp-block-buttons,.t2-featured-template-post .t2-post-dynamic-part .wp-block-buttons{margin-top:var(--wp--preset--spacing--40)}.t2-featured-query-post:has(a:not(.wp-block-button__link):hover) img,.t2-featured-single-post:has(a:not(.wp-block-button__link):hover) img,.t2-featured-template-post:has(a:not(.wp-block-button__link):hover) img{transform:scale(1.05)}.t2-featured-query-post:has(a:not(.wp-block-button__link):hover) .t2-post-dynamic-part.meta-abstract,.t2-featured-query-post:has(a:not(.wp-block-button__link):hover) .t2-post-title,.t2-featured-query-post:has(a:not(.wp-block-button__link):hover) .wp-block-dekode-story-abstract,.t2-featured-single-post:has(a:not(.wp-block-button__link):hover) .t2-post-dynamic-part.meta-abstract,.t2-featured-single-post:has(a:not(.wp-block-button__link):hover) .t2-post-title,.t2-featured-single-post:has(a:not(.wp-block-button__link):hover) .wp-block-dekode-story-abstract,.t2-featured-template-post:has(a:not(.wp-block-button__link):hover) .t2-post-dynamic-part.meta-abstract,.t2-featured-template-post:has(a:not(.wp-block-button__link):hover) .t2-post-title,.t2-featured-template-post:has(a:not(.wp-block-button__link):hover) .wp-block-dekode-story-abstract{color:var(--wp--preset--color--primary-hover)}.t2-featured-query-post.has-background,.t2-featured-single-post.has-background,.t2-featured-template-post.has-background{border-radius:8px}.t2-featured-query-post.has-background .post-content,.t2-featured-single-post.has-background .post-content,.t2-featured-template-post.has-background .post-content{padding:var(--wp--preset--spacing--40)}.t2-featured-query-post.has-background .t2-post-link,.t2-featured-single-post.has-background .t2-post-link,.t2-featured-template-post.has-background .t2-post-link{padding-bottom:0}.t2-featured-query-post.has-background .t2-post-dynamic-part.term-category,.t2-featured-single-post.has-background .t2-post-dynamic-part.term-category,.t2-featured-template-post.has-background .t2-post-dynamic-part.term-category{background:var(--wp--preset--color--background-200)}.t2-featured-query-post.t2-featured-content-layout-col-12.has-background .t2-post-title,.t2-featured-single-post.t2-featured-content-layout-col-12.has-background .t2-post-title,.t2-featured-template-post.t2-featured-content-layout-col-12.has-background .t2-post-title{padding-left:0;padding-right:0}@media (min-width:64rem){.t2-featured-query-post.t2-featured-content-layout-col-12,.t2-featured-single-post.t2-featured-content-layout-col-12,.t2-featured-template-post.t2-featured-content-layout-col-12{display:grid;grid-template-columns:1fr 1fr}.t2-featured-query-post.t2-featured-content-layout-col-12.has-image-right .t2-post-link.featured-image,.t2-featured-single-post.t2-featured-content-layout-col-12.has-image-right .t2-post-link.featured-image,.t2-featured-template-post.t2-featured-content-layout-col-12.has-image-right .t2-post-link.featured-image{order:1}.t2-featured-query-post.t2-featured-content-layout-col-12 .t2-post-featured-image,.t2-featured-single-post.t2-featured-content-layout-col-12 .t2-post-featured-image,.t2-featured-template-post.t2-featured-content-layout-col-12 .t2-post-featured-image{height:100%}.t2-featured-query-post.t2-featured-content-layout-col-12 .post-content,.t2-featured-single-post.t2-featured-content-layout-col-12 .post-content,.t2-featured-template-post.t2-featured-content-layout-col-12 .post-content{display:flex;flex-direction:column;justify-content:center;padding:var(--wp--preset--spacing--70)}.t2-featured-query-post.t2-featured-content-layout-col-12 .t2-post-title,.t2-featured-single-post.t2-featured-content-layout-col-12 .t2-post-title,.t2-featured-template-post.t2-featured-content-layout-col-12 .t2-post-title{font-size:clamp(1.45rem,2rem,2.8rem)}.t2-featured-query-post.t2-featured-content-layout-col-12 .t2-post-dynamic-part.meta-abstract,.t2-featured-single-post.t2-featured-content-layout-col-12 .t2-post-dynamic-part.meta-abstract,.t2-featured-template-post.t2-featured-content-layout-col-12 .t2-post-dynamic-part.meta-abstract{font-size:var(--wp--preset--font-size--text-medium)}.t2-featured-query-post.t2-featured-content-layout-col-12 .t2-post-dynamic-part .wp-block-buttons,.t2-featured-single-post.t2-featured-content-layout-col-12 .t2-post-dynamic-part .wp-block-buttons,.t2-featured-template-post.t2-featured-content-layout-col-12 .t2-post-dynamic-part .wp-block-buttons{margin-top:var(--wp--preset--spacing--50)}}.t2-featured-query-post.block-editor-block-list__block.t2-featured-content-layout-col-12,.t2-featured-single-post.block-editor-block-list__block.t2-featured-content-layout-col-12,.t2-featured-template-post.block-editor-block-list__block.t2-featured-content-layout-col-12{display:block}@media (min-width:64rem){.t2-featured-query-post.block-editor-block-list__block.t2-featured-content-layout-col-12 .is-root-container.block-editor-block-list__layout,.t2-featured-single-post.block-editor-block-list__block.t2-featured-content-layout-col-12 .is-root-container.block-editor-block-list__layout,.t2-featured-template-post.block-editor-block-list__block.t2-featured-content-layout-col-12 .is-root-container.block-editor-block-list__layout{display:grid;grid-template-columns:1fr 1fr}}
